This is the place to be!! The Palms Resort Myrtle beach direct ocean front luxury suite on the 14th floor (Million Dollar view of the Ocean/Beach). Recently modernized with Granite countertops/furnishings/handsome tile floor/Stainless Steel appliances/non-smoking 3 bedrooms and 2 bathrooms. Master has King bed, 2nd bedroom Queen bed and 3rd bedroom has 2 single beds also a pull out couch couch so can sleep 8 very comfortably. Has 3 balconies and 2 of them face the ocean, 1 balcony has a dining room table in it only place at myrtle with that so you can eat all your meals/Drink morning coffee out there as a family and see all the way down the beach listening to the waves. This condo is a relaxer's heaven.
Only 2 condos on each floor so this is a nice family aligned peaceful resort with plenty of space on the beach/pools during peak season (Not busy like other giant resorts).
There's a full living room (60"' flatscreen TV), full kitchen with all pots/pans/silverware/cups/mugs to prepare. All 3 TV's (1 Living room, 1 Master, 1 in 2nd bedroom) have cable with 86 channels, DVD Players to watch your favorite movies, and also intelligent TV's so you can login to your Netflix, Disney, HULU, YouTube, Paramount, or any other App you want to and appreciate your favorite sports/shows.
Located half mile north of the Skywheel/boardwalk and only a 5 min drive to Broadway at the beach. Has an indoor pool, 2 indoor hot tubs, kiddie pool and gym. Also outdoor heated pool and hot tub.
Hundreds of eateries, golf, Putt Putt, convention center 1/2 miles away, Broadway at the Beach, nightlife and entertainment are a short distance away. You are in the heart of Myrtle Beach and part of all of the activity!

Tips to get the best Myrtle Beach rental experience:
When to book a Myrtle Beach rental & When to go:
- To book the most suitable vacation home for your budget, we strongly suggest reserving in the Spring or Fall. You'll enjoy lower rates, greater selection, beautiful weather and the absence of large crowds at Myrtle Beach restaurants, beaches, and activities.
- Reserve your rental as soon as possible. Rental schedules often open 12 months in advance (or in September just after the Summer season ends). Many groups book their Summer rental homes during Thanksgiving and Christmas get-togethers. Reserve before these holidays for best selection.
- Active Duty and veterans of the US Armed forces may be qualified for special discounts. Be sure to ask your prospective property owner whether your vacationing group qualifies for a special rate.
- Property managers usually offer their guests an option to purchase vacation insurance protection. Trip insurance, which will generally cost 1% - 5% of the reservation price, offers visitors reimbursement of costs for days missed as a result of medical-related issues or weather disasters, as well as ensuing additional evacuation costs, such as an unanticipated hotel stay or additional fuel expenses. Trip insurance is definitely a bank account-saver if the unforeseen occurs. Ask the property owner for more information.
- Many property management companies and vacation rental houses supply Myrtle Beach area travel guides which often include coupons, either offered independently by local businesses, or by way of a relationship with the management company and the business itself. You can also find Myrtle Beach visitors guide and coupon books at local shops and grocery stores.

More considerations:
- Review check in & check out procedures before traveling. Save the instructions to your phone, and take a printed backup.
- To make sure that no damages are linked to your visit, inspect the rental for any problem areas during check in. message the property manager immediately to document your findings. If there is a dispute, having a record of problems and contact attempts will be valuable.
- Ask questions. You may want instructions for a hot tub, elevator or appliance. Contact your property manager. They are there to help! A brief phone call can prevent lots of concerns.
- Be respectful of your neighbors. Often times, surrounding homes are occupied by local residents. Respecting late-night quiet hours and parking policies is the right thing to do.
- Don't forget to... Ask a local resident! Local residents can usually point you in the right direction. Who better to ask where to find the best seashells, have a great night on the town, or the best spots for fine dining?
- Protect the owner (and your things!) by keeping the rental locked up when you are out, just like you would at home.
- Upon check-out, take a final walk-through to make sure you haven't forget anything. Make sure to check garages, decks, and cabinets for hidden treasure. Clean the refrigerator and take or dispose of leftovers.
- Document the condition of the property at check-out. We recommend taking a video during your final walk-through.
- After your trip, leave a review! Property owners rely on excellent reviews to stimulate more reservations. They'll be much obliged for your review. Alternatively, if something wasn't right, other families will be thankful you shared your experience find their best vacation home. Be fair with your review. If something fell short of expectations, consider whether the manager had any control over the issue, and if so, whether they responded reasonably to solve it.
